is the leading technology company creating a new category of “Decision Maker Marketing”. The most important decisions are made by the hardest people to reach and influence. Historically, C-suite leaders have lacked the tools to reach the stakeholders that matter most to their business. The C-suites of hundreds of Fortune 500 companies, major agencies, trade associations, nonprofits, and governments use Applecart to put their best content in front of business critical decision makers and those they trust —  from policymakers and investors to CEOs, key employees, members of the media and more. Decision makers are informed by what they read, learn from advisors, hear from colleagues, and discuss with family and friends. To break through to them, you must reach them through the only channel that really moves them: those they know and trust. Applecart’s platform uses publicly available or fully permissioned data to map billions of social relationships between nearly every American adult and enable clients to deliver content directly to decision makers and those that matter most to them.

Applecart advises the C-suites of hundreds of industry-leading organizations spanning dozens of Fortune 500 companies, top communications and advertising agencies, major trade associations, leading nonprofit organizations, and governments. Applecart’s platform enables CEOs, Chief Corporate Affairs Officers, CCOs, CMOs and other C-suite executives to generate visibility for their most valuable content with critical decision makers and those in their orbits across nearly any channel. Clients leverage Applecart across a broad range of strategic communications use-cases from public affairs and corporate communications to investor relations, employee relations, and brand marketing.
